Your Role as Optician:

Strong communication and customer service skills are essential for this position. We will be asking you to greet and advise patients who have received a recommendation for eyewear and spectacle lenses from the optometrist, Dr. Michael Murphy. 

Responsibilities:

• Advise patients about spectacle lens technology;

• Provide superior customer service and patient care; 

• Use the appointment scheduling and record search software, patient records, and other tools at your disposal to record accurate and clear notes about the patient encounter; 

• Ensure the quality and accuracy of all completed eyewear and complete electronic patient records; 

• Maintain acceptable performance according to professional standards; 

• Manage frame inventory within budget guidelines;

• Stay current and adapt to changes in protocols, procedures and the products and services offered; 

• Be an ambassador for our practice in the community; 

• Perform any other tasks requested by the doctor or your coworkers; 

• Participate in special projects as needed;

• Perform the required tests during eye exam as needed.
